- the present invention relates to a heel protector and, more particularly, to a heel protector adapted to maximally prevent friction between a user's heel and shoes, and to prevent formation of calluses and blisters on the heel caused by the friction.
- FIG 11 One of the known arts for maintaining healthy feet is shown in FIG 11 , in which Japanese Utility Model No. 3032803 entitled, "Dryness Preventing Socks," is described.
- this Utility Model the overall border of an inner pad member (520a) attached to a heel is connected to a sock (510a) by stitching (530a) in the shape of the heel.
- stitching 530a
- the overall inner pad member (520a) is secured to the sock and the only effect is to prevent dryness of the heels.
- FIG 13 illustrates a schematic drawing of Japanese Utility Model No. 3021145 , the purpose of which is to prevent dryness of feet in the socks.
- a central portion of an inner pad member (520c) is fixedly stitched (530c) to prevent the inner pad member (520c) from slipping. Thus, it cannot prevent formation of calluses or blisters caused by friction.
- a heel sock for warming feet by way of far-infrared ray disclosed in Japanese Utility Model No. 3018319 and illustrated in FIG 14 includes a body member (510d) having a cut-off front part and an inner pad member (520d) additionally formed inside the body member (510d), where a marginal portion and a central portion of an inner pad member (520d) are connectedly sewn (530d) to the body member (510d). Therefore, in this utility model, there is a drawback in that calluses and blisters caused by friction cannot be prevented from being formed.
- the present invention is disclosed to solve the aforementioned drawbacks and it is an object of the present invention to provide a heel protector configured to maximally restrict friction generated between a heel and a shoe from occurring while walking, thereby preventing formation of calluses and blisters.
- the heel protector includes a body member made of a flexible fabric material for being worn on the feet and an inner pad member coupled to an inside of the body member for accommodation to an area where a heel is located when the heel protector is worn, wherein both distal ends of longitudinal direction of the inner pad member are coupled to the body member, and two areas of the inner pad member accommodated to both lateral sections of the heel are coupled to the body member, such that the inner pad member can relatively slide in relation to the body member when the heel protector is worn.
- the body member has a cylindrically bent shape.
- the inner pad member has a substantially oblong shape, and each of the two areas coupled to the body member is a portion of a lateral distal end of the inner pad member.
- the inner pad member is cut in the shape of a "V" at both longitudinal central portions of edges thereof.
- the body member is provided with an elastic band at at least one of upper and lower distal ends thereof.
- a heel protector (10) according to the present invention includes a body member (100) and an inner pad member (200).
- the body member (100) has a cylindrically bent "L" shape and is made of a flexible fabric material.
- the body member (100) has a shape of a sock cut out at a front section thereof A user may wear the body member (100) just like a sock or may insert the body member (100) inside a sock to encompass the heel of the user.
- the inner pad member (200) of a substantially oblong shape for accommodation to an inside of the body member (100) is coupled to an inner section of the body member (100) for being snugly fitted to the heel when the sock is worn.
- the inner pad member (200) is described to have a substantially oblong shape, it should be appreciated that the shape of the inner pad member does not limit the scope of the present invention as long as it teaches a hereinafter-described technical characteristic in relation to a coupled shape between the inner pad member and the body member.
- the inner pad member (200) and the body member (100) are sewn for coupling therebetween.
- both longitudinal distal ends of the inner pad member (200) are stitched to the body member (100) to allow the inner pad member (200) and the body member (100) to be stitched along the stitching line (210).
- a part of both lateral distal ends of the inner pad member (200) are connected to the body member (100) via thread rings (400).
- the thread ring (400) serves to tie the inner pad member (200) and the body member (100) for being snugly fitted to both lateral ends of the heel.
- both longitudinal distal ends of the substantially oblong inner pad member (200) are sewn to the body member (100) by the stitching line (210). Furthermore, central marginal sections in the longitudinal direction of the inner pad member (200) are tied to the body member (100) by the thread rings (400) such that sections to which the body member (100) is not affixed can be relatively moved in the opposite direction against the body member (100).
- the central marginal section is a part of lateral distal ends of the inner pad member (200) and corresponds to an area of the inner pad member (200) accommodated to a lateral section of the heel.
- the inner pad member (200) is loosely connected to the body member (100) in order to promote a relative smooth movement between the inner pad member (200) and the body member (100).
- a predetermined space is formed between longitudinal distal end of the inner pad member (200) and distal end of the body member (100) as shown in FIG 1 , and a longitudinal distal end of the inner pad member (200) and a distal end of the body member (100) may be directly connected as illustrated in FIG 3 .
- a band (300) for maintaining elasticity may be disposed at an upper end or a lower end of the body member (100) in order to increase comfort and stability in wearing the heel protector (10).
- An ankle can be protected by the band (300) that wraps and applies pressure to the upper and lower ends of the heel.
- the band (300) at the lower end of the body member (100) can further produce an effect of applying pressure to the sole for remedial treatment.
- the body member (100) is made of a flexible fabric material and is formed at both distal ends thereof with a band (300).
- An inner pad member of a substantially oblong shape is sewn along a stitching line (210) and both distal ends of the body member (100). Furthermore, the band (300) and the body member (100) are coupled by said stitching line (210).
- a predetermined amount of space is formed between the inner pad member (200) and the body member (100) before the heel protector is worn, and when the heel protector is worn by a user, the body member (100) is stretched or expanded to fit the shape of a foot and the inner pad member (200) is accommodated to the heel.
- a predetermined amount of space is formed between the inner pad member (200) and the body member (100) even after the heel protector is worn such that a smooth sliding can be effected between the inner pad member (200) and the body member (100).
- the body member (100) is made of 55% nylon/spandex and 45% cotton.
- the area contacting the body member at the inner pad member (200) is made of 100% polyester while the area of the inner pad member (200) accommodated to the heel is made of fabric woven with micro polyester.
- the heel protector according to the embodiment of the present invention is configured such that free movement can be effected between the body member (100) and the inner pad member (200) due to less friction while greater friction is produced at an area where the inner pad member (200) and the heel are mutually contacted, thereby preventing the heel from slipping with the inner pad member (200).
- soft and supple artificial fur made of micro polyester is used for an area contacting the heel at the inner pad member (200) to increase friction with the heel and to prevent occurrences of skin damage, whereby a comfortable feeling created by warmth and softness can also be provided when the heel protector according to the present invention is worn.
- FIGS. 8 to 10 illustrate still a further embodiment where all constructions are the same as those of the previous embodiments except for a 'V'cut-out at each marginal center of the inner pad member (200) such that the inner pad member (200) can be easily folded at the cut-out section.
- inclined surfaces of the 'V' cut-out section overlap each other to be coupled to the body member (100) via the thread ring (400).
- the heel protector of the present invention When a user wears the heel protector of the present invention on his or her foot, the heel of the foot is snugly fitted to the inner pad member (200) while other areas of the foot are supported by the body member (100).
- a predetermined amount of space is preferably formed between the inner pad member (200) and the body member (100) for a smooth sliding therebetween.
- a material of one surface of the inner pad member (200) contacting the heel has a greater friction force while a material of the other surface of the inner pad member (200) and a surface material of the body member (100) contacting thereto have less friction force therebetween.
- the user may wear a sock on top of the heel protector.
- Both longitudinal distal ends and a part of both lateral distal ends of the inner pad member in the heel protector according to the embodiments of the present invention are affixed to the body member such that the inner pad member (200) and the heel are simultaneously moved at an area where the heel is substantially accommodated and calluses and blisters can be formed.
- the inner pad member (200) wraps around the heel of the user to thereby restrict friction from occurring between the heel and the inner pad member (200), and friction caused by sliding is generated between the inner pad member (200) and the body member (100) to effectively prevent formation of calluses or blisters caused by the friction between the heel and the shoes.
- the heel protector can be manufactured with a simple construction to enable to simplify the manufacturing process and reduce the manufacturing cost.
- the inventor conducted clinical demonstrations by having a user wear the heel protectors according to the embodiments of the present invention.
- a test was conducted on fifteen male Ssirum (Korean wrestling) athletes and ten male adults in which they walked 80 kilometers for three nights and four days wearing the heel protectors (20 kilometers per day totaling 32 hours). Even after the long and tedious walks, no problems were found on the skins of the heels. In other words, calluses or blisters were not found on the skins of the heels.
- the heel protectors had supported the ankles to provide the wearers psychological comfort, without resulting in sprained ankles.
- the heel protectors according to the embodiments of the present invention are useful to professionals including athletes, soldiers and the like who are frequently on their feet.
- the formation of calluses or blisters can be effectively prevented by the heel protectors of the present invention even for the general public when they work out, climb mountains or go for a walk.
